ABOUT SOUND

Headquartered in Tacoma, WA, Sound Physicians is a physician-founded and led, national, multi-specialty medical group made up of more than 1,000 business colleagues and 4,000 physicians, APPs, CRNAs, and nurses practicing in 400-plus hospitals across 45 states. Founded in 2001, and with specialties in emergency and hospital medicine, critical care, anesthesia, and telemedicine, Sound has a reputation for innovating and leading through an ever-changing healthcare landscape — with patients at the center of the universe.

ABOUT THE ROLE

This position is responsible for supporting selected post-acute Telemedicine programs by running start up processes and day-to-day operations. Activities include implementing new telemedicine service, supporting continuous process improvement, supporting accounting practices, and generally maintaining weekly and monthly performance management cycles.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

Administrative & Operations Support

  • Complete technical setup of new programs in technology platforms and supporting administrative systems.
  • Partner closely with the Account Managers to ensure client expectations are consistently met.
  • Help Sound Physicians central service teams in accounting, IT, legal, HR, etc as needed for client accounts.
  • Work with regional telemedicine business and clinical team to identify, design, and implement best practices which ensure smooth communication, capture of necessary data, and optimal clinical and financial performance.
  • Identify opportunities in daily workflows and assist the leadership team in problem solving and resolution.
  • Maintain system data to ensure accurate operational reporting, e.g. make sure the account level data is kept up to date.
  • Provide ongoing technical troubleshooting for live Telemedicine programs.
  • Additional projects as assigned.
  • Understand, and review for accuracy, regular operations reports for assigned sites. Identify concerning trends and participate in the development and implementation of corrective action plans.
